Technical Info

What are your basic technical requirements?

A small performance area: I just need a flat, stable surface of about 2x2 meters (or 6x6 feet).
Access to a power outlet (If amplification is required): I require access to one standard electrical outlet for my small, high-quality amplifier and equipment.
For outdoor events: I must have adequate cover, such as a canopy, umbrella, or shaded area. This is crucial to protect my delicate wooden instrument from direct sun or potential rain.


What information do you require about a venue?

To ensure a flawless performance, here is the key information I typically need beforehand:
Logistics: The full venue address, parking/load-in details, and the name and mobile number of an on-site contact person (like a planner or venue manager).
Performance Area: Confirmation if the space is indoors or outdoors, the exact setup location, and the proximity of the nearest power outlet.
Schedule: A basic timeline of the event, including my performance start/end times and the timings for any specific musical cues (e.g., the bride's entrance).


Do you provide sound and lighting equipment?

I do not provide large PA systems, speakers for a DJ, or microphones for speeches and announcements. Those broader audio-visual needs are best handled by your DJ or a dedicated AV rental company that specializes in production for the entire event.

What's your previous experience and how did you start gigging?

I’m classically trained, having studied at the renowned Conservatori del Liceu here in Barcelona. I began my career playing in orchestras and chamber groups, which I loved, but the shift to solo events was a happy accident. A friend asked me to play at his wedding, and the experience was a complete revelation.

In an orchestra, you're part of a huge sound but distant from the audience. There, I saw the direct emotional impact the music had on everyone. It wasn't about perfect technique; it was about pure connection.

After that first wedding, my career grew organically through word-of-mouth. I quickly realized that using my skills to create a personal soundtrack for people's most important moments was what I was truly meant to do. I've been chasing that feeling ever since.


Which artists have you been most influenced by, who is your favourite artist and what is the greatest song of all time?

My influences are broad. On the classical side, it’s J.S. Bach; his work for solo violin is the foundation for any violinist. As a performer, I'm hugely inspired by the raw emotion of Itzhak Perlman. Beyond that, I draw from the melodic genius of film composer Ennio Morricone and even bands like Queen, who were masters of musical drama.
My favourite artist is probably Morricone. He was a master of telling a complete, emotional story with just a melody.
As for the greatest song of all time, that's an impossible question! But if forced to choose, I’d say the Prelude to Bach's Cello Suite No. 1. It's pure, distilled emotion that feels less like it was written and more like it was discovered. It is timeless perfection.

Performance Info

What are your typical setup and performance times?

Setup Time
I always plan to arrive at the venue 45 to 60 minutes before I am scheduled to begin playing. This gives me ample time to connect with your event coordinator, find my designated spot, set up my equipment discreetly, and do a quick, quiet sound check. The actual setup process only takes about 15-20 minutes, so I am always ready well before your first guests arrive.
Performance Times
This is completely tailored to your event, but here are the most common formats:
Wedding Ceremony: Typically a one-hour booking, which includes 15-20 minutes of prelude music as guests arrive, plus the music for the key parts of the ceremony itself (processional, signing of the register, recessional).
Cocktail Hour/Reception: This is usually booked by the hour. A standard hour of performance consists of 45-50 minutes of music, with a short 10-15 minute break.
Everything is flexible and can be customized to fit your schedule perfectly.


Are you happy to perform outside?

I am more than happy to perform at outdoor events, provided one crucial condition is met: I must have adequate cover.
My violin is a delicate and valuable wooden instrument, and it simply cannot be exposed to direct sunlight or the risk of rain and moisture. The sun can quickly damage the instrument's wood and varnish, and dampness can be disastrous.
This protection can easily be provided by a canopy, a marquee tent, a covered terrace, or a large, stable event umbrella.
As long as that simple requirement is met to keep the instrument safe, I would be delighted to help create the perfect musical atmosphere for your outdoor event.
